Is this a huge result for Michael Beale? You bet it is.
Just when the Rangers manager needed a statement victory, his newlook team delivered to get their Europa League campaign off to a superb start.
They had to work for it against a Real Betis side who were on top for 35 minutes before Gers got a grip of the game and never let go.
It took an ugly, scrambled finish from Abdallah Sima to deliver the three points but the goal was celebrated with all the gusto that has greeted so many huge European victories in Govan.
And maybe, just maybe, Beale and his team have recaptured the hearts and minds of the support who hadn't quite given up on them but had serious misgivings about the team that had started the season so shakily.
The last time Rangers had a home match in this competition, it was all a little bit different. May 5, 2022 saw RB Leipzig beaten 3-1 to send Giovanni van Bronckhorst's side to Seville and Ibrox's foundations were tested to the limit as the stadium throbbed with excitement and positivity.
"I'm Feeling It" was the song of the moment but 16 months later the support isn't even if they did give their team a rousing welcome.
Only four of those who beat Leipzig in that Europa League semi-finalJames Tavernier, Connor Goldson, Borna Barisic and John Lundstram - were in last night's starting X1.
And as Real Betis came to town, the feeling that Rangers were stronger then than they are now wasn't easy to dismiss.
But this was the challenge for the current side - to prove the doubters wrong and get the support back on side, Beale was without the injured quartet of Nico Raskin, Todd Cantwell, Kieran Dowell and Danilo.
